摘要
This study systematically assesses the process mining scenario from 2005 to 2014. The analysis of 705 papers evidenced discovery' (71%) as the main type of process mining addressed and categorical prediction' (25%) as the main mining task solved. The most applied traditional technique is the graph structure-based' ones (38%). Specifically concerning computational intelligence and machine learning techniques, we concluded that little relevance has been given to them. The most applied are evolutionary computation' (9%) and decision tree' (6%), respectively. Process mining challenges, such as balancing among robustness, simplicity, accuracy and generalization, could benefit from a larger use of such techniques.
